**Build Provenance: Cold Starts on Lanternfield Handlers**

Welcome aboard. Our serverless handlers on the Lanternfield platform cold-start whenever a new deployment rolls out or an instance is reclaimed. Each cold start logs the provenance of the artifact being loaded, so we can confirm the running code matches what CI signed. If a handler misbehaves after a deploy, compare its logged provenance against the release manifest before debugging further. Every cold-start log entry begins with the build token, reproduced here.

build token for kagaf-hahof: htk14_9d3d4d26d7d8de

Finance Review Summary — Gross-Margin Review. Prepared for heads of department at Velmora Goods. Blended gross margin slipped 1.8 points this quarter, driven mainly by input-cost inflation on the Larkstone line and discounting in the Perrow channel. Mitigations underway include supplier renegotiation and revised list pricing. Detailed tables are attached. The confidential commentary on forward plans appears directly below.

board note of kajeg-yaduf: The renewal with Oliixix Group closes at $5 million a year, 5 percent above the last contract. Project Ulaael slips by one quarter because of the tooling delay.

## Formula sandbox tuning

User-supplied formulas in Gridmoor execute inside a restricted interpreter with hard ceilings on time, memory, and call depth. Reviewers should confirm any change to these ceilings is justified in the PR description, since raising them widens the abuse surface. Defaults were chosen from production traces. The current limits are as follows.

limits module of tafog-fawip:
WEIGHTS = {
    "julix": 57,
    "lamys": 992,
    "kasvan": 209,
    "quenok": 750,
    "alddor": 259,
    "oliath": 1009,
    "wenix": 815,
}